Don't get the 1.8 lude tranny it will not work unless you get the lude axles and hubs. I tried the 1.8 lude swap and it is a waste of money unless it is your only option.
Here is what I had to do to get close to working.
With the 1.8 I had to grid some to get clearence around the preasure plate. Then I had to use the the accord differental so the axles would fit. Then I had to use the accord main shaft and counter shaft so the they would match up with the diff. That means you have to use the accord shift rod and accord gear case. Then I found out that everything binds up cause the different gear thickness, the lude gears don't sit right on the accord shafts. WASTE OF TIME.
The best thing to do is get the 85-87 Si tranny, it will bolt right up no problem.
